Step by Step Method
Step 1
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
Step 2
Place a large sheet of aluminum foil on a medium baking sheet.
Step 3
In a medium bowl, mix the bread, celery, cranberries, walnuts, onion, and garlic. Season with sage, marjoram,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per. Stir in the egg and enough broth or hot water to moisten.
Step 4
Arrange turkey legs on the foil sheet, and season with salt and pepper. Spoon the bread mixture around the legs, and dot with butter.
Step 5
Tightly seal the foil around the legs and bread mixture.
Step 6
Bake 1 hour in the preheated oven, or until the turkey leg meat has reached an internal temperature of 180 degrees F (80 degrees C)
